About
Lost & Found: A This Bed We Made Story is a standalone 1–2 hour DLC that expands on the events of This Bed We Made. Playing the main game first is recommended, but optional.

We are now in 1964. Sophie has taken a new posting aboard the Orpheus, a transatlantic ship, a few years after the events at the Clarington Hotel. What was meant to be a fresh start is disrupted when colleagues and passengers begin reporting missing personal belongings…
Set entirely indoors within a small section of the ship, Lost & Found builds on the investigative gameplay of This Bed We Made through an intimate, self-contained narrative experience. Everyday tasks once again become part of the investigation, bringing back more of the cleaning and snooping players wanted more of!
A focused narrative mystery set aboard a 1960s transatlantic ship, where small details carry unexpected weight.
Make the beds, tidy up, and tend to each cabin… where small details rarely stay hidden.
Snoop through cabins and shared spaces, inspecting personal items in 360° to uncover hidden details.
Converse with colleagues and passengers as secrets surface in unexpected ways.

A quick and cozy short adventure featuring the return of Sophie Roy, the sweet, soft spoken heroine from This Bed We Made. If you enjoyed the previous full game, then yes this is a good addition for you. If you haven't played This Bed We Made, you'll appreciate this short game a lot more if you start with This Bed We Made first, even though Lost & Found could be a stand-alone. There are just some things going on with Sophie that will be more significant if you experienced her past. Lost & Found is little less than half the play time as This Bed We Made, but it kind of felt even less due to fewer emotional story arcs. Lost & Found has a few subtle ones that just hang on in the background (like Sophie's grieving her mom, and Sophie's career path) that you don't directly engage with until all is said and done. Same mechanics and format as This Bed We Made...point and click, look for clues, figure out what it all means. And I was glad to watch the end credits all the way through...there is quick scene at the end setting up the next game or DLC. This is definitely worth the few dollars to buy. I hope it encourages the studio to continue Sophie's story through future releases.
